Chavez Elementary ranking

SchoolRow ranks Chavez Elementary 3,649th of 5,659 California elementary schools for 2024–25, based on CAASPP 2024–25 English and Math results — better than 36% of elementary schools statewide. Its statewide percentile went from 39th in 2015 to 36th in 2025.

Frequently asked questions

What school district is Chavez Elementary in?

Chavez Elementary is part of the Long Beach Unified district in Long Beach, California.

Is Chavez Elementary a good school?

SchoolRow ranks Chavez Elementary 3,649th of 5,659 California elementary schools (better than 36% statewide) based on 2024–25 test results (CAASPP 2024–25).

What is the racial makeup of Chavez Elementary?

Hispanic 75%, Black 13%, White 7%, Two or more races 3% (307 students, 2023–24).
